WebCommon Factors. A factor of a number is an exact divisor of the given number. Every factor of a number is less than or equal to the given number, i.e. it cannot be greater than the given number. Every number has at least two factors, some numbers have more than two factors. For example, 1, 2, 3, and 6 are the factors of 6. WebFactors of 142. WebSep 27, 2012 · factoring 142=2*71 999=3*3*3*37 no common factor so common multiple is 142*999=141,858 other mutliple woudl jsut be twice or three times or four thimes etc …
